    Álvaro Cardozo is an illustrator from Bogotá, Colombia who invested his time and effort into becoming a digital illustrator, despite initially studying graphic design. After successfully carrying out his first illustration project at university, he was contracted by an animation studio to join their production team, designing scenes, characters, props, and storyboards, until he was eventually promoted to an Art Director position.

    He began his freelance career in 2014. Since then, he has worked with advertising agencies, production studios, video game studios, and authors on a range of international projects. His client portfolio includes video game and animation studios like Skew Studio in the UK, Oruga Touching Dreams, and Autobotika, as well as editorial work for Penguin Random House and independent writers.     You’ll learn how to create characters, environments, and covers; master composition, color, lighting, and visual storytelling techniques for animation, games, and books; and build a professional portfolio that makes an impact.

    This course is aimed at intermediate learners—perfect for those with basic digital illustration skills who want to deepen their understanding of visual storytelling and art direction.

    You’ll need basic Photoshop skills, a computer with the program installed, a graphics tablet (recommended), and a willingness to practice composition and color techniques.

    The course guides you step-by-step to define your style, select your best work, and build a portfolio that highlights your strengths, creativity, and personal style for clients and publishers.

    You’ll learn how to work with light, contrast, and color palettes; adjust temperature and saturation; create mood and visual hierarchy; and design Color Scripts to convey emotion in your scenes.

    Yes, the course includes hands-on exercises to develop storyboards, color scripts, and visual storytelling skills applicable to animation and game projects.

    It covers customizing the interface, managing layers, channels, brushes, selections, masks, color adjustments, CMYK proofs, and digital lighting techniques.
